On Wednesday, March 7th the All Stars Project kicked off the campaign for our National Gala at Lincoln Center with a reception hosted by real estate management firm CBRE. This year's gala at the David Koch Theatre will honor Gregory A. Tosko, Vice Chairman of the CBRE Tri-State Region, and Bart M. Schwartz, Esq., Chairman of Guidepost Solutions, and their commitment to building the quality afterschool programs of the All Stars Project. The All Stars Project will also announce the creation of the Scott Flamm Center for Afterschool Development, which the organization will open in Newark at the end of the year.

"When I think about our gala honorees, Greg and Bart, I couldn't think of a more fitting title for our May 7th benefit than Big Builders for Young People. Both of them go out of their way every day to help children growing up in this city who struggling in the face of poverty, under-performing schools, and violence. Thanks to Greg and Bart, the All Stars Project is going to reach thousands of young people this year and give them hope and opportunity," says All Stars Project President & CEO, Gabrielle L. Kurlander. 

Mary Ann Tighe, CEO of the CBRE New York Tri-State Region, headlined this launch of Greg Tosko's campaign for the celebration of his 15-year support of the All Stars Project's young people. 50 CBRE professionals, All Stars young people and leaders joined Tosko and Tighe at the kick-off event.

Thanks to leadership involvement from Greg, CBRE has been a sponsor of the All Stars Project since 2005. Dozens of members of the firm have been supporters, and have also volunteered their time. CBRE SVP Dan Knopf serves as a Trustee for the Development School for Youth, and along with Chairman of Global Brokerage Steve Siegel, has created unique experiences for All Stars youth over the years. In addition to championing All Stars at CBRE, Greg serves on the All Stars Project's Board of Directors and plays a key role in our Finance and Audit Committee. He has advised the All Stars on real estate matters, hosted workshops for young people, and has been a personal champion of our work.
